引言
漯河开源事故是一起引起广泛关注的事件,涉及开源项目的管理和开发过程。本文旨在揭秘事故的处理结果,并对整个事件进行深入分析和反思。
事故背景
漯河开源事故起源于一个开源项目,该项目由漯河市某政府部门发起,旨在通过开源方式提高政府工作效率。然而,在项目实施过程中,出现了一系列问题,导致事故的发生。
处理结果揭秘
1. 调查结果
事故发生后,相关部门迅速成立调查组,对事故原因进行了深入调查。调查结果显示,事故的主要原因包括:
- 项目管理不善:项目缺乏明确的计划和进度安排,导致开发进度滞后。
- 代码质量问题:部分代码存在严重缺陷,影响了系统的稳定性和安全性。
- 团队协作不足:团队成员之间沟通不畅,导致问题无法及时发现和解决。
2. 处理措施
针对调查结果,相关部门采取了以下处理措施:
- 停止项目开发:为确保系统安全,项目被暂停开发。
- 修复代码缺陷:组织专业团队对代码进行修复,提高系统稳定性和安全性。
- 加强项目管理:制定详细的项目管理计划,明确责任人和进度安排。
- 加强团队协作:建立有效的沟通机制,提高团队协作效率。
真相与反思
1. 真相
漯河开源事故揭示了开源项目在管理和开发过程中可能存在的问题,包括项目管理不善、代码质量差、团队协作不足等。
2. 反思
a. 项目管理
事故表明,项目管理在开源项目中至关重要。为了提高项目管理水平,应采取以下措施:
- 制定详细的项目计划:明确项目目标、进度安排和资源分配。
- 建立有效的沟通机制:确保团队成员之间的信息畅通。
- 定期进行项目评估:及时发现和解决问题。
b. 代码质量
代码质量是开源项目的生命线。为了提高代码质量,应采取以下措施:
- 严格执行代码审查制度:确保代码符合规范和质量要求。
- 引入自动化测试工具:提高测试效率和质量。
- 鼓励代码贡献者参与:集思广益,共同提高代码质量。
c. 团队协作
团队协作是开源项目成功的关键。为了提高团队协作效率,应采取以下措施:
- 建立良好的团队文化:鼓励团队成员之间的沟通和协作。
- 定期组织团队活动:增进团队成员之间的了解和信任。
- 明确团队成员职责:确保每个人都清楚自己的工作内容和目标。
结论
漯河开源事故的处理结果揭示了开源项目在管理和开发过程中可能存在的问题。通过对事故的深入分析和反思,我们可以从中吸取教训,提高开源项目的管理水平,为我国开源事业的发展贡献力量。
